My story

Here's what the humans have to say about me:


This is Donnie he's 10 months old my wife and I adopted him in July. We got him for me mainly but also because we believed every baby should grow up with a cat, my son at that time was 18 months old seemed to be doing fine when we brought him home. Unfortunately recently we have noticed that after playing with Donnie our son has began to develope red spots on his face, arms, and legs. Seems to be some sort of allergic reaction which I don't feel right separating them both to separate parts of the house. He's good with children or at least one baby and he doesn't seem to mind being around dogs. We have three small dogs in our home. He doesn't go out of his way to interact with them and neither do the dogs seems to be bother with it by him. He is litter trained and loves to eat. He does like to climb and scratch he is not declawed. He is a hit or miss type of little guy whether he wants to be by himself but mainly he is a cuddly little guy and like to play your shadow.
